dc.description.abstractLegislation stability principle or principle of Legislation constantly is one of the most significant principles that consolidate legal law sought law by The foreing investing oil companies, for it make the realized investing project governed by a static and ditermined law since oil contract is concluded to its expiration. However, there might be some considerably changing economical, social and political conditions in which this contrat is concluded within, in a way that makes the continuity of enforcing oil legislation clauses and its prior provisions before such condition, leading to instability of contractual relation and an imbalance in its partie’s commitment, the fact that leads to implement the principle of renegotiation to ensure the continuity of contractual relation amid changing conditionsen_US
